The Irish dancing scene is alive and buzzing, especially when feiseanna are in session! These gatherings, often referred to as “feis fever,” are a crucial part of a young dancer's development. Imagine energetic halls filled with the sound of tin whistles, bodhráns, and the distinct tapping of ghillies. Dancers of all ages compete in various dances, from solo reels and jigs to challenging ceili and set dances. It's more than just the pursuit of medals; feiseanna offer invaluable experience, feedback from qualified judges, and a chance to connect with the wider community. Many families and supporters make the journey to support their favorite performers, creating a truly memorable and electric atmosphere.
